Disaster Response Manager

Duty station: Dushanbe
Closing date: Open until filled

Habitat for Humanity Tajikistan (HFHT) is seeking an experienced person for the position of Disaster Response Manager to implement Disaster Response (DR) program of HFHT and enable strategic and innovative disaster risk reduction, preparation, mitigation, and response through the development of programs aligned to HFH strategy and industry standards/good practice.

Duties and responsibilities:
  • Coordinate and manage all HFHT Disaster Response projects, including;
    • Risk & Needs Assessment;
    • Disaster risk reduction;
    • Organizational and operational preparedness;
    • Community based mitigation interventions;
    • Response;
    • Disaster Response Advocacy and Policy development;
  • Implement HFHT DR program in line with HFH International (HFHI) strategic development and contribute to achievement of national Disaster Risk Reduction and Response strategic objectives;
  • Develop and keep updated HFHT DR training curriculum and materials;
  • Provide DR training;
  • Represent HFHT in all DR related meetings and conferences including all REACT/ SNFI cluster meetings;
  • Explore partnership opportunities with other local and international NGOs operating in DR field and keep productive relation with existing partners;
  • Monitors and evaluates all HFHT DR projects and provides comprehensive recommendations;
Requirements:

Required:

  • Development and/or Management and/or Disaster related formal education;
  • At least 3 years of experience in the field of disaster risk reduction both in project management and DR training development;
  • Knowledge and experience in disaster project design and management;
  • Operational and financial management skills;
  • Coaching/consultancy/advisory skills;
  • High proficiency in English and Tajik required;
  • Experience in using Word, Excel, Power Point and databases;
  • Excellent interpersonal skills;
  • Ability to work independently and without close supervision.

Preferred:

  • Construction management or Construction Trades qualification - seismic engineering;
  • Working experience in INGOs;
  • Proficiency in Russian;
  • Understanding of and working experience in the Europe and Central Asia region as well as its cultural/social/political environment.
